Coloring Tips & Techniques

Try using deep purple for the bat body and soft pink for the inner ears to make it friendly and fun. Add bright yellow or silver for the stars and moon, use light strokes to blend colors on the wings, and add darker shading near the body to show depth. Outline the eyes with a black crayon and color tiny white highlights to keep them shiny.
